Just a word of caution, the guy has almost no feedback and doesn't seem to have bought/sold anything bike related before. I'd hate to see you get your fingers burnt. If you win the auction I'd only send £100 deposit by paypal and insist on the rest in cash on collection.
I usually ask for a photo of the item against a current newspaper is poss as it tends to link the buyer with the item.
